Football (Boys)
The Football Program at Susquehannock teaches the fundamental skills of football: passing, catching, kicking, and basic plays, and incorporates them into a safe, non-tackling game known as "Razzle Dazzle" Football. This allows an emphasis on the athletic and mental components of the game without needing all campers to suit up in all the equipment traditional football requires. There is a focus on agility, communication with teammates, improvisation, and movement without the ball - fundamental skills that translate well to any sport - in a much safer environment.
For those campers who expect to be playing competitive football in the Fall season, there are intensive fitness training programs available.
There are also clinics and occasional competition in Rugby, and have experienced players on staff to teach both the basics and the finer points. This exposure to a "foreign" sport is part of the international flavor of Susquehannock.
